WebAug 30, 2024 · cp: cannot copy a directory into itself #43 Closed rabywastaken opened this issue on Aug 30, 2024 · 1 comment rabywastaken commented on Aug 30, 2024 … WebJan 11, 2024 · Copy with extglob: cp -r ! (new_subdir) new_subdir If you have extglob enabled for your bash terminal (which is probably the case), then you can use ! to copy all things in the current directory which are not new_subdir into new_subdir. Copy without extglob: mv * new_subdir ; cp -r new_subdir/* .
WebFirst, move the new directory out (with a temp name to avoid conflict), then delete the original directory, then rename the new directory into place. Note: because this will involve deleting things en masse, think it through carefully before just running these commands, and make sure you have a backup first.
